Understanding the Appeal of Disposable Vaping Devices

Disposable e-cigarettes are praised for their simplicity and portability. Users seeking a straightforward nicotine experience often prefer these devices for their ready-to-use nature, eliminating the need for charging or refilling. According to recent industry data, the average disposable vape contains between 1.0 and 2.0 ml of e-liquid, delivering roughly 300 to 600 puffs, which is comparable to traditional cigarette consumption. This convenience is coupled with an increasing variety of flavors—ranging from classic tobacco and menthol to exotic options like mango and bubblegum—that appeal to a broad demographic spectrum, especially younger consumers.

The Sociocultural Impact and Future Outlook

Particularly among youth demographics, disposable devices have become a cultural phenomenon—driven partly by social media marketing and flavors that appeal to younger palates. Critics argue that this trend could undermine decades of tobacco control progress, fostering nicotine dependence among minors.

Looking forward, regulatory agencies such as the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) are debating stricter measures, including flavor bans and manufacturing standards. Industry insiders project that innovation in non-nicotine alternatives and safer delivery systems could further transform this market sector.
